IAC POSTDOCTORAL FELLOWSHIP Stellar Populations 2026

TheIAC (Tenerife) invites applications forONE postdoctoral contract to work on the project linked to the line of research “Traces of galaxy formation: stellar populations, dynamics and morphology”. The contract is funded by the project “Baryonic Cycle and its Stellar populations (B-CycleS)” (PID NB-I00), led by Dr. Ignacio Martín-Navarro

Research topics at the IAC include most areas of astrophysics: Solar Physics (FS), Exoplanetary System and Solar System (SEYSS), Stellar and Interstellar Physics (FEEI), The Milky Way and The Local Group (MWLG), Formation and Evolution of Galaxies (FYEG), and Cosmology and Astroparticles (CYA-CTA).
